CareerPath

Game Developer: Involved in coding and creating gameplay mechanics, ensuring technical feasibility, and implementing game features, especially for projects focused on humanitarian themes. Game Designer: Responsible for conceptualizing game levels, characters, and narratives, with an emphasis on integrating social messages and educational content related to humanitarian efforts. Quality Assurance Tester: Focuses on testing games to identify bugs, ensuring a smooth user experience, and verifying that humanitarian messages are effectively communicated through gameplay. Game Artist: Creates visual elements of games, including characters, environments, and animations, contributing to the emotional impact of humanitarian narratives through visual storytelling. Project Manager: Oversees the game development process, coordinating teams and resources to ensure timely delivery, especially for projects aimed at raising awareness on humanitarian issues. Sound Designer: Develops audio elements, including sound effects and background music, enhancing the immersive experience of games that tackle humanitarian themes. Other Roles: Includes various positions such as marketing specialists and community managers, all aimed at promoting games that serve humanitarian causes and fostering community engagement.
